Hi Waldemar, Could you explain why is this should belong to django staticfiles app? This app has nothing to do with combining css files. It has one view (django.contrib.staticfiles.views.serve) in order to serve files in development. This is only a helper view used in development and I don't see why it is necessary to support css-combining solutions in it. If some app combines/compresses css/js files it should handle the path rewriting etc. and provide a way to insert the media into templates (e.g. via templatetag as django-compress do) because all these stuff can be handled in different ways. django.contrib.staticfiles (and it's serve view) doesn't stand in the way here and I think it's the best it could do. If django.contrib.staticfiles prevents something to be implemented then it's an another story and this should be fixed.
